In case anyone is interested in how I sorted out the 3 into 5 won't go
problem: I wired the 30 amp cable into terminal 1 (live) and 3 (neutral)
then I made a link between terminals 1 and 2 and between 3 and 4 using
small loops of heat resistant cable.
